To run this subcommand, you must have the Server Control
privilege.
Synopsis
racadm krbkeytabupload [-f <filename>]
<filename> is the name of the file including the path.
Input -f — Specifies the filename of the keytab uploaded. If the file is
not specified, the keytab file in the current directory is selected.
Output
When successful Kerberos Keytab successfully
uploaded to the RAC message is displayed. If unsuccessful,
appropriate error message is displayed.
Example
racadm krbkeytabupload -f c:\keytab\krbkeytab.tab
lclog
Descripti
on
Allows you to:
• Export the lifecycle log history. The log exports to remote or
local share location.
• View the lifecycle log for a particular device or category
• Add comment to a record in lifecycle log
• Add a work note (an entry) in the lifecycle log
• View the status of a configuration job.
NOTE: When you run this command on Local RACADM, the
data is available to RACADM as a USB partition and may
display a pop-up message.
